Mod Lacquer "Atomic Age"


Hello lovelies!

I have another pretty from Mod Lacquer for you today! I showed you some amazing neons earlier this week. Now it's time for some holo action, so meet "Atomic Age"!



"Atomic Age", part of the World's Fair Collection, is a deep plum jelly packed with scattered holo; in fact, it is so packed with scattered holo that it almost becomes a linear. Really cool!
This is two coats of "Atomic Age", which applied utterly easily and was almost opaque even in 1 coat! For short nails, one could totally get away with one coat, if one were in a hurry. (That's a lot of 'one's!) I am seriously impressed by this.


I am seriously in love with this polish and I will probably use it a lot in the future! I'm really happy that I got to swatch for Mod Lacquer, it has been a blast!
